Proklaim is a solo rap artist who was born in Uganda and raised in Zambia. His art found expression in Namibia. Through his songs, he fervently worships the divine. And he’s discovered that hip-hop is a good outlet for his artistic energies. His main influences are Tupac, Nas, Fuges, Wutang, Drake and Jay Z. Through his lyrics, which are infused with emotion and dedication in every verse, he seeks to glorify the name of God. The “Kingz” music video has also been featured on MTV Base. With his creative musicality and diverse cultural background, Proklaim is ready to make his mark in the music industry.

Proklaim’s recent release, “Promised Land” takes the listeners on a nostalgic journey back to the soul sample boom-bap beats era that defined hip-hop in the early 2000s. The song is replete with sharp wit and proverb-like lyrics that are engaging and thought-provoking. The tasteful instrumentalization evokes nostalgia as well as resonates with the contemporary listeners. This joining of hands of old school vibes and timeless themes makes this song a strong contender for a classic!
